Trove Penarth: A Real Treasure

If you’re a fan of Drew Pritchard’s Salvage Hunters, you’ll love Trove; it’s full of unique items to add those cool touches that will make a house your home.

Owned by television and film prop buyer Helen O’Leary, Trove is a celebration of the eclectic. From artwork to furniture, lighting to soft furnishings, Trove is the culmination of Helen’s search for the cool, classic and contemporary. She has a very good eye. I should know having been a bit of a skip rat in my time.


Helen has been prop sourcing for the last thirteen years. She has a degree in Art & Aesthetics, so she knows a thing or two about design and interiors.


Just looking around, there’s cool, original artwork and prints, circus, fairground and showman signs, advertising memorabilia, kitchenalia, vintage and retro lighting, ornaments from the 1930s onwards; mid-century furniture, Skandi items, garden wear and lovely soft furnishings – if it’s out there, Helen will find it. “I offer a sourcing service!” she says proudly.


I’ve no doubt, with her little grey book of contacts she could probably find anything you need. She taps into her network and is in demand from interior designers and private collectors. “The shop is the natural extension of my crazy obsession with lovely, quirky things,” she adds.


She says her long term plan might mean opening another shop – she has several containers of collectibles and curios so probably has enough stock. Looking for that certain unique something for your home, pop into Trove. If you’re anything like me, you’ll love it.
